Definition of rubber (noun)
- an elastic material obtained from the latex sap of trees (especially trees of the genera Hevea and Ficus) that can be vulcanized and finished into a variety of products
- synonyms: caoutchouc, gum elastic, India rubber, natural rubber
- any of various synthetic elastic materials whose properties resemble natural rubber
- synonyms: synthetic rubber
- an eraser made of rubber (or of a synthetic material with properties similar to rubber); commonly mounted at one end of a pencil
- synonyms: pencil eraser, rubber eraser
- contraceptive device consisting of a sheath of thin rubber or latex that is worn over the penis during intercourse
- synonyms: condom, prophylactic, safe, safety
- a waterproof overshoe that protects shoes from water or snow
